Autonomous cardiac implant of the leadless capsule type, including a piezoelectric beam energy harvester

The device includes an energy harvesting module with a pendular unit formed of an elastically deformable piezoelectric beam associated with an inertial mass. A multifunction part includes an axial through-recess with inner bearing surfaces opposite respective outer faces of the beam. These bearing surfaces having an increasing transverse spacing, such as, during an oscillation cycle, the beam comes into contact with one of the bearing surfaces, hence reducing the free length of the beam as the bending of the latter goes along. The multifunction part also allows rationalizing the manufacturing and the assembly of the capsule, with high-level integration of the inner components of the implant.

Optical signal processing device

ActiveUS20110228374A1Easily adjustShortens free space optical systemCoupling light guidesNon-linear opticsIntermediate pointPhysics
In a conventional optical signal processing device, a confocal optical system is configured in which a focusing lens is positioned at a substantially-intermediate point of a free space optical path. Thus, the free space optical system had a long length. It has been difficult to reduce the size of the entire device. The optical signal processing device of the present invention uses a lens layout configuration different from the confocal optical system to thereby significantly reduce the length of the system. The optical signal processing device consists of the first focusing lens positioned in the close vicinity of a signal processing device, and the second focusing lens positioned in the vicinity of a dispersing element. A distance between the dispersing element and the signal processing device is approximately a focal length of the first focusing lens. Compared with the conventional technique, the length of the optical path can be halved.

Method for adjusting the vibration frequency range of a sound producing device with vibrating tongues

The invention concerns a method for adjusting the vibration frequency range of a sound producing device with vibrating tongues. The device includes an assembly formed of a comb extended by at least one vibrating tongue, said comb having at least one hole for the securing thereof to a support by means of a support jaw and of a tightening element traversing the support jaw and the hole in the aforecited comb. According to the method, the frequency range is adjusted by reducing the free length of the vibrating tongue or tongues by the localised clamping of said tongues between the support jaw and a local counter-support.

Compensation device for valve opening and closing mechanism

The invention discloses a valve for compensation device for fluid medium control valve opening and closing mechanism. The valve is composed of a valve body, a valve cover, an opening and closing mechanism and a compensation device. The opening and closing mechanism comprises a pressure sensing element, a main spring and a valve plug, and is arranged in the valve body. The pressure sensing elementand the valve cover form a pressure sensing element cavity. The compensation device comprises an upper compensation spring, a lower compensation spring and a piston, and is arranged in the valve body.Pressure on two sides of the pressure sensing element separately acts on two ends of the piston. When P1-(P3+F) is greater than 0, the piston moves to the direction of less pressure, the lower compensation spring is compressed and the valve plug is closed until the P1-(P3+F) is equal to 0, the differential pressure is controlled to be a preset value, and the valve plug is in a balanced state; andwhen the P1-(P3+F) is less than 0, the piston moves to the direction of greater pressure, the upper compensation spring is compressed and the valve plug is opened until the P1-(P3+F) is equal to 0, the differential pressure is controlled to be the preset value, and the valve plug is in a balanced state. The problem in the prior art that control precision error is high is effectively solved.

An integrated deep water foundation and its construction method

This application relates to an integrated deep-water foundation and its construction method, and relates to the technical field of bridge deep-water foundations, including multiple suction single wells, multiple steel pipe columns, multiple bored piles and caps. The steel casing used for bored pile construction, and the steel pipe column and the single suction well are an integrated structure prepared in advance. After the drainage operation of the single suction well, the steel pipe column and the single suction well can sink to the design elevation. There is no need to erect a large jacket platform and carry out processes such as hoisting, turning over, and sinking of steel casings in the marine environment with harsh swell conditions, and the suction well base and steel pipe columns can participate in the stress of the deep water foundation during the bridge use stage Among them, the free length of the single pile can be effectively reduced, and the horizontal and vertical bearing capacity of the pile body can be improved. Therefore, the application can not only reduce the construction risk, difficulty and cost, but also shorten the construction period and improve the horizontal bearing capacity and vertical bearing capacity of the pile body.
